diff options
Diffstat (limited to 'x11-plugins/wmudmount')
-rw-r--r-- | x11-plugins/wmudmount/Manifest | 5 | ||||
-rw-r--r-- | x11-plugins/wmudmount/metadata.xml | 4 | ||||
-rw-r--r-- | x11-plugins/wmudmount/wmudmount-2.2.ebuild | 34 | ||||
-rw-r--r-- | x11-plugins/wmudmount/wmudmount-3.0.ebuild | 42 |
4 files changed, 49 insertions, 36 deletions
diff --git a/x11-plugins/wmudmount/Manifest b/x11-plugins/wmudmount/Manifest index bf32a5ab0671..66e50e662f92 100644 --- a/x11-plugins/wmudmount/Manifest +++ b/x11-plugins/wmudmount/Manifest @@ -1,5 +1,6 @@ AUX wmudmount-2.2-perl_brace_regex.patch 417 BLAKE2B cada3b139df63f9cc78c2d6bdb3f243c3fac5d4517c166de6cfc166439beedf7398510ab9ff76596316db6b3ad6dd8fb234e42d55614e89bfaed671614e0ed18 SHA512 93afa7793d64cf0d3f2e7be5a112fbf8c8823006e97f8d7c654d5aed91e8578012558b8cafce43c73b09c6279ca3a9741214bd851899c63f3eb5cd0641862c73 DIST wmudmount-2.2.tar.gz 181700 BLAKE2B f375aca9da44b5cba1483b70c36bbed81d897a691ce91ca5d3e11f8bbbbe1cc46685480d41144d6cca0bd10f625e46b5eec2ffc573ec7dd90b9b241dde7605a2 SHA512 6bc08b60430bbe66710ce183f0e7693a7818cee68cefac3a3bc191104663dd3649f8cdb62c7f214bdf4ed377b01fef250fe388f14645690aab7993c6071ceffe +DIST wmudmount-3.0.tar.gz 189435 BLAKE2B e04c0bedfd4d0f4deed88f3acc87e4f2871890d6d12811404ec6c884107ae6bd9df17e724100068b08ff31ae557a02cd20bfc86222111939984fcc7916466c06 SHA512 dd12354d281ab04255e4ecf600d05c661168ed69b48439bba4ee6e61f2c93507e35e45c6f6671426c26df2fcf17ba5e851a6a3a3d757a5016a49bd8f76893eb9 EBUILD wmudmount-2.2-r2.ebuild 913 BLAKE2B ba78be7d9870e82c11d622b141e824717336b4c319e46add3a4aeabdac7df059f291df8faad2f7a777abff50a683dfd4f98435f55af32c49a3020e8703156b8e SHA512 35cdd7552465185f61632233bcedee4584bbdcfd1b7407a23420e15fac7d43e40efcb39a80f52f69ba24aefb662260b8b9765c602a81e814e60d7810b8f68818 -EBUILD wmudmount-2.2.ebuild 902 BLAKE2B 56afc5aada175b7623c238146fc74c68ba12779e5c9df60b1f3e043a6b9753e83e6bff4dce4f2e9f1831490f312e41f6b900d4249731f352f5a33599849b3e0a SHA512 c99a70da25007efcac2c16eec30420fba944dd43b1a54a43c84370bf45d7d67668acf0f41d859474e378103652a2eae1ad02e1c92438f4aa704bba63404a8689 -MISC metadata.xml 331 BLAKE2B 17327d6a39e4d1bc33e46b0e3e958713aac557a46aa2d478d455abdd9911531d6292c044604ebbdece25adb283fd80ed90538ebe18e910b4bb24ccd39a290cef SHA512 c930e5cae4d2478d607c0e1c21c4979cb49ec11140cddd5789844cce0bab5c48922f69306f26e98ca4c6d95939c93d2d5dcd99326a74886228839d9e30edc3c9 +EBUILD wmudmount-3.0.ebuild 890 BLAKE2B 45bc69eeb97827668d7264039e9c22700c60d9b9a1ec719295a64d7bc24244104538a4a52be8d39f3ac9c981f06f7401e50946e14ee3934654208ba146e16514 SHA512 4069af02d388550fb3053e223a835168b23bc0daa9741aa50346e206a30e97116714a96fff43c512808118b357f50a8bbc96146a32793f0380b2b592d5c06ad7 +MISC metadata.xml 534 BLAKE2B 78e714f2a755ed296605508da6d108981d3748cf63a5858a92157d60a8dfc27926a64ade1475737b78b2743d389dc5223df2ebe22969f8202a0cc5609e1ff5a9 SHA512 cec2ed0232a608f12d33b6f986210f09c14fc2c4e21c249ead8b2bcbe286e398e2cedf19548a6f6b1d1ec893f6bf1c2820f5908f841693e3bffca6fff25389eb diff --git a/x11-plugins/wmudmount/metadata.xml b/x11-plugins/wmudmount/metadata.xml index f78dad9d13a3..658d5857f5dc 100644 --- a/x11-plugins/wmudmount/metadata.xml +++ b/x11-plugins/wmudmount/metadata.xml @@ -5,6 +5,10 @@ <email>voyageur@gentoo.org</email> <name>Bernard Cafarelli</name> </maintainer> + <use> + <flag name="gcr">Enable support for secure memory with <pkg>app-crypt/gcr</pkg></flag> + <flag name="secret">Enable support for secret service with <pkg>app-crypt/libsecret</pkg></flag> + </use> <upstream> <remote-id type="sourceforge">wmudmount</remote-id> </upstream> diff --git a/x11-plugins/wmudmount/wmudmount-2.2.ebuild b/x11-plugins/wmudmount/wmudmount-2.2.ebuild deleted file mode 100644 index 19b97bee0ef5..000000000000 --- a/x11-plugins/wmudmount/wmudmount-2.2.ebuild +++ /dev/null @@ -1,34 +0,0 @@ -# Copyright 1999-2015 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 - -EAPI=5 -inherit eutils gnome2-utils - -DESCRIPTION="A filesystem mounter that uses udisks to handle notification and mounting" -HOMEPAGE="https://sourceforge.net/projects/wmudmount/" -S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="amd64 x86" -IUSE="gnome-keyring libnotify" - -RDEPEND="sys-fs/udisks:2 - >=x11-libs/gtk+-3.8.0:3 - gnome-keyring? ( gnome-base/libgnome-keyring ) - libnotify? ( >=x11-libs/libnotify-0.7 )" -DEPEND="${RDEPEND} - virtual/pkgconfig - || ( media-gfx/imagemagick[png] media-gfx/graphicsmagick[imagemagick,png] )" - -DOCS="ChangeLog" - -src_configure() { - econf \ - $(use_with libnotify) \ - $(use_with gnome-keyring) -} - -pkg_preinst() { gnome2_icon_savelist; } -pkg_postinst() { gnome2_icon_cache_update; } -pkg_postrm() { gnome2_icon_cache_update; } diff --git a/x11-plugins/wmudmount/wmudmount-3.0.ebuild b/x11-plugins/wmudmount/wmudmount-3.0.ebuild new file mode 100644 index 000000000000..9b83e5ecdee5 --- /dev/null +++ b/x11-plugins/wmudmount/wmudmount-3.0.ebuild @@ -0,0 +1,42 @@ +# Copyright 1999-2018 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 +inherit gnome2-utils + +DESCRIPTION="A filesystem mounter that uses udisks to handle notification and mounting" +HOMEPAGE="https://sourceforge.net/projects/wmudmount/" +S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="gcr libnotify secret" + +RDEPEND="sys-fs/udisks:2 + >=x11-libs/gtk+-3.16.0:3 + gcr? ( app-crypt/gcr ) + libnotify? ( >=x11-libs/libnotify-0.7 ) + secret? ( app-crypt/libsecret )" +DEPEND="${RDEPEND} + virtual/pkgconfig + virtual/imagemagick-tools[png]" + +DOCS="ChangeLog" + +PATCHES=( "${FILESDIR}"/${PN}-2.2-perl_brace_regex.patch ) + +src_configure() { + econf \ + $(use_with gcr) \ + $(use_with libnotify) \ + $(use_with secret) +} + +pkg_postinst() { + gnome2_icon_cache_update +} + +pkg_postrm() { + gnome2_icon_cache_update +} |